Navigating the legal intricacies of British Columbia's commercial landscape requires a discerning eye and keen attention to detail. Here are the pivotal elements to consider:
Every locale within BC, from the urban pulse of Victoria to the serene backdrop of smaller towns, has its zoning guidelines:
Zoning Compliance: It's paramount to ensure that the business's operations align with the zoning regulations of its location. For instance, a commercial venture in a predominantly residential area might face challenges.
Licensing Prerequisites: The type of business determines its licensing needs. A restaurant in Victoria, for instance, would have different licensing requirements than a tech startup. If the culinary world beckons you, peruse through the restaurant listings in Victoria to grasp the nuances.
Special Permits: Certain businesses, especially those with a more pronounced environmental or health impact, may require special operational permits.
Understanding these legal aspects ensures that your investment is not just a venture but a vision that stands on solid regulatory ground. In British Columbia, employment laws and regulations ensure employers and employees operate harmoniously and fairly. These laws dictate everything from wage standards and working hours to more intricate details such as employee benefits and protocols for terminations or layoffs. As a potential business owner, it's imperative to familiarize oneself with these frameworks. This ensures your business operations remain compliant post-acquisition and foster a positive work culture.
When eyeing businesses for sale in BC, it's essential to dive deep into the operational facets of the potential acquisition. This involves a thorough evaluation of the existing equipment and infrastructure. One must question the age and condition of machinery, its maintenance history, and potential compatibility with prospective upgrades. For instance, if you're considering a logistics venture, the condition of the moving fleet becomes paramount. Speaking of which, our listings of moving businesses offer insights into such operational nuances.
Furthermore, given BC's rich ecological tapestry, potential environmental issues associated with the business need scrutiny. This includes ensuring waste management protocols adherence, emission standards compliance, and potential or historical environmental impact assessments. A proactive approach safeguards against future liabilities and upholds the province's commitment to environmental sustainability.

Acquiring a business in British Columbia comes with the intrinsic responsibility of managing employee and customer expectations. Their perceptions and experiences during the transition phase can significantly influence the venture's future trajectory.
Employee Expectations:
Transparent Communication: Ensure regular updates about the acquisition process and how it might impact roles.
Reassurance: Address any concerns and provide assurances about job security and prospects.
Integration Sessions: Conduct workshops or meetings to familiarize employees with new operational procedures or business visions.
Customer Expectations:
Seamless Service: Ensure that the acquisition does not disrupt the service or product quality that customers are accustomed to.
Open Channels: Keep communication channels open for customers to voice concerns or seek clarifications.
Maintain Brand Identity: While it's natural to bring in some changes, ensuring continuity in brand identity can help retain customer trust.

What should I consider before purchasing a business in BC?
Before you decide to purchase a business in British Columbia, it is crucial to carefully assess its financial wellbeing. This involves examining factors like revenue, profits, and outstanding debts. In addition to the financial aspects, it is important to evaluate the competitive landscape, potential growth opportunities, as well as the legal and regulatory requirements that apply to the specific industry.
What is the process of buying a business in BC?
When purchasing a business in British Columbia, individuals undergo a comprehensive process that entails thorough research, seeking professional advice, and developing a sound business plan. This involves assessing potential businesses, negotiating purchase terms, conducting due diligence, securing financing, and fulfilling all required legal documentation and registrations with pertinent government authorities.
Do I need a lawyer or business broker when purchasing a business for sale in BC?
While not legally required, it is highly recommended to engage a lawyer or business broker when purchasing a business for sale in BC. Their expertise ensures the proper handling of transactions, documentation, and negotiations. These professionals provide valuable insights and support to protect your interests throughout the process.
Are there any available grants or financing options specifically tailored to purchasing a business in British Columbia?
In British Columbia, individuals looking to purchase a business can access various grants and financing options. These opportunities encompass government-backed loans, private lending alternatives, and regional business development grants designed to assist aspiring entrepreneurs in acquiring established enterprises.
What are the tax implications of buying a business in BC?
Potential buyers in British Columbia should carefully consider several tax implications when purchasing a business. These implications include sales tax, property transfer tax, income tax on business earnings, and possible tax liabilities related to the acquired business. It is highly advisable for individuals to seek guidance from a qualified tax professional who can assist them in fully understanding and navigating their obligations regarding taxes associated with the acquisition.
How do I perform due diligence before purchasing a business for sale in BC?
To ensure a smooth business acquisition in BC, it is essential to conduct thorough due diligence. This involves meticulously examining the financial records, legal documents, and operations of the business you intend to purchase. It is advisable to seek guidance from professional advisors such as lawyers and accountants to verify the business's standing and identify any potential hidden liabilities.
